Danger Averted As Overland Airways Aircraft Catches Fire During Landing At Lagos Airport
Fred Omotara, Lagos
A major air disaster was averted on Wednesday night when an Overland Airways aircraft carrying 33 passengers made an emergency landing at the Murtala Muhammad International Airport, Lagos, from Ilorin International Airport in Kwara state.
According to eye witness report made available to kadecommunicationng, “The incident happened on Wednesday night, June 15, when one of the engines caught fire mid-air as the plane was approaching the airport runway.
“33 passengers onboard the flight were safely disembarked at the international Wing after the plane successfully made an emergency landing,” the eyewitness who wouldn’t want his name in print told kadecommunicationng.
